Explosions Heard At House Fire In Puyallup
The fire broke out after 5 p.m. southwest of the state fairgrounds, according to police.

PUYALLUP, WA - A structure fire broke out Tuesday afternoon at a home along 12th Street Southwest in Puyallup, and witnesses reportedly heard explosions coming from the home. Around 5:45 p.m., firefighters had determined that all occupants had made it out of the home safely.
At around 6 p.m., firefighters reported that the fire was under control, although personnel were still on scene mopping up.

The home is located along the 1800 block of 12th Street Southwest, which is just west of 9th Street Southwest.
